Alpitronic Demonstrates HYC1000 System, Fast-Charging the New Mercedes-AMG GT 4-Door Coupé

On September 4, 2026, pv magazine reported that Alpitronic demonstrated its HYC1000 system at the ICNC26 event at Tempelhofer Feld in Berlin on September 3, 2026, using the new Mercedes-AMG GT 4-Door Coupé. Charging power quickly surpassed 500 kW before reaching more than 600 kW. The charger display showed 612 kW during the demonstration and later approximately 620 kW.

Mercedes-AMG developer Johannes Nab said the vehicle’s 800-volt battery was engineered for sustained high-power charging. The battery uses directly cooled cells and technology inspired by Formula 1. Mercedes-AMG says the vehicle can charge from 10% to 80% in approximately 11 minutes.

The automaker also estimates that 10 minutes of charging at 600 kW can add more than 460 kilometers of WLTP range.

Italian EV charging equipment manufacturer Alpitronic introduced the HYC1000, a distributed DC fast-charging system capable of delivering up to 1 MW of total power and charging as many as eight electric vehicles simultaneously.

The system uses a central power cabinet connected to separate charging dispensers. The cabinet supports up to eight DC outputs, with available power dynamically distributed between vehicles in 62.5 kW increments. This allows charging-site operators to shift available power between charging points based on demand rather than dedicating fixed power electronics to individual chargers.

The HYC1000 incorporates eight second-generation silicon carbide power stacks. Each stack provides 125 kW and up to 400 amps, with efficiency exceeding 98%, according to Alpitronic.

The HYC1000 operates from 150 V to 1,000 V and provides up to 600 amps per output. Alpitronic offers multiple dispenser configurations, including an MCS dispenser supporting up to 1,500 amps, a dual-CCS2 EV dispenser and a liquid-cooled high-power dispenser capable of exceeding 1,000 amps.

The system is designed for highway charging hubs, commercial fleets and destination charging. Its distributed architecture could help operators make more efficient use of limited electrical capacity while supporting multiple high-power charging sessions.

Alpitronic Is Building the Hardware Behind the EV Charging Revolution

Italian company Alpitronic is emerging as a major force in the global electric vehicle charging industry, focusing on high-power DC fast-charging technology designed for passenger vehicles, commercial fleets and major charging hubs.

Founded around power electronics expertise, Alpitronic began developing and commercializing its Hypercharger DC fast-charging systems in 2017. Its current portfolio ranges from compact 50 kW chargers to the 400 kW HYC400 and the new HYC1000 distributed charging system capable of delivering up to 1 MW.

Alpitronic says its Hyperchargers are installed in 62 countries, with 131,000 charging ports installed and more than 252 million charging sessions recorded. The company reports that its network has delivered 7.6 TWh of energy.

With EV batteries becoming larger and charging rates continuing to increase, charging infrastructure will be just as important as the vehicles themselves. Alpitronic’s focus on efficient, scalable and high-power charging puts the company directly at the center of that transition.
